Protecting Your Treasures: Understanding Assurance D’Antiquités

As a collector or owner of valuable antiquities, whether they be fine art, jewelry, or historical artifacts, it is essential to ensure the protection of these valuable assets. One of the most important ways to safeguard your treasured items is through insurance coverage specifically tailored for antiquities, known as “assurance d’antiquités.” This specialized form of insurance provides unique coverage to protect against risks such as theft, damage, or loss, which may not be adequately covered by standard insurance policies.

assurance d’antiquités provides coverage for a wide range of valuable items, including but not limited to antiquities, fine art, jewelry, and historical artifacts. This type of insurance is designed to protect these items from a variety of risks, such as theft, accidental damage, natural disasters, and vandalism. By obtaining assurance d’antiquités, collectors can have peace of mind knowing that their valuable items are adequately protected.

One of the key benefits of assurance d’antiquités is the specialized coverage it offers for valuable and unique items. Unlike standard insurance policies, which may have limitations on coverage for high-value items, assurance d’antiquités is designed to provide comprehensive protection for valuable antiquities. This type of insurance may include coverage for events such as theft, accidental damage, fire, flood, and other risks that are specific to valuable items such as fine art and historical artifacts.

In addition to providing coverage for a wide range of risks, assurance d’antiquités can also offer additional benefits for collectors and owners of valuable items. Some policies may include coverage for restoration costs in the event that a valuable antique is damaged, as well as coverage for loss of value due to damage or theft. This can be particularly valuable for collectors who have invested significant time and money into acquiring and maintaining their valuable items.

Another important aspect of assurance d’antiquités is the appraisal process that is typically required to obtain coverage. In order to determine the value of a valuable item and assess the level of risk associated with insuring it, insurers may require an appraisal by a qualified expert. This appraisal process helps to ensure that the collector is adequately covered for the true value of their valuable items, and can help to establish a fair premium for the insurance coverage.
